Tobias Portmann wrote:
> Try "lsof /dev/dsp" to see, which application uses /dev/dsp. Close it,
> and then it (perhaps) works!
>
> Tobi
>
> [KS] wrote:
>
>> Hi all,
>>
>> Whenever I try to start Totem, it gives me an error "OSS device /dev/dsp
>> is already in use by another program." and quits. How can I get it to
>> work?
>>
>> All other sound applications like xine, xmms, etc work fine and don't
>> complain about /dev/dsp being busy.
>>
>> /KS
>>
lsof doesn't give me anything :(
~# lsof /dev/dsp
~#
Any other pointers?
